Introduces per-class payout configuration (percentage or hourly rate, plus an optional per-session expense allowance), pure calculation utilities for professor payout/net profit/receivables, and a new financial-reports API surface with per-class, per-session, and date-range/monthly reports. Also adds full CRUD for institutional expenses used in the range report, and wires up the new permissions and roles. Fixes a pre-existing ReferenceError (missing parseImportDate import) in paymentService that blocked creating payments with dated transactions.
